Understanding Riven day, I shouldn’t really complain about the loading times – they’re certainly faster than shuffling through a damaged jewel case full of PS1 discs – on the Quest on the other hand you’d be sitting there for a month and Will wait for a range of loads, the longest of which is the initial startup display screen which the game warns “may take a few minutes” (it happens). From there, whether on Quest or SteamVR, car transitions will repeatedly throw out a 10-second loading monitor, which doesn’t tone down much, but happens on either side of the transfer between islands.
Any other problem: The ill-conceived strategy of writing notes so you can hold on to clues or caricature answers is what you’ll actually want to do to decode the stuff. You’ll snap a screenshot with the game’s integrated camera device, and that’s it. I just wish there was a spatial pencil so I could annotate discovered letters, or somehow save myself having to start the headset and write stuff down.
I was looking forward to playing the game on both the Quest 3 native and PC VR versions. Here is the difference between the two, at most one can guess.
In the Quest model you’ll encounter a ton of low-resolution textures and geometry that dynamically load as you get closer to the playing field. As soon as issues occur on the playing field, even if from time to time Riven The Quest platform will also have possibly the most beautiful video games ever. If there aren’t any NPCs around, they’re bloated and too cartoony for the game’s lush, natural environment.
It additionally turns out that Cyan is throwing all the toolbox of Quest efficiency strategies at you, including always-on asynchronous spacewarp and what looks like clearly viewable fixed foveated rendering.
Because it was originally developed for the flatscreen PC society, the PC VR model is significantly ahead of the Quest 3 local in terms of optics. Even on ‘Epic’ settings though, you’ll definitely notice some oddly applied shaders that create shadows and rotate when they shouldn’t, and similarly inconsistencies in how the shaders work in each eye. There are also, some of which are beautiful visual mismatches. In shadow and light fixtures. still. Chunk-loading of fields is generally minimal and textures are reasonably high, making this a more graphically intensive version of the game.

Riven As well as offering some details of the week’s options, the assurance offers a full range of options that make things negligibly more simple, but potentially less intensive as a result. Travel between the islands is always done on some form of automobile, which may be of little inconvenience to some as it is fast and a little jerky.
You’ll turn off the car’s transitions entirely, essentially letting you jump to the then-island’s train station, or put the windows in the process of getting dirty, giving you negligible extra space in the car’s cockpit. The game additionally offers matching options for faster transit of stairs and ladders, which are climbable manually in a different manner.
